MetaMask(メタマスク)のアニメーションアイコン設定方法




MetaMask(メタマスク)のアニメーションアイコン設定方法


MetaMask(メタマスク)のアニメーションアイコン設定方法

本記事では、ブロックチェーン技術を活用したデジタルウォレットであるMetaMask(メタマスク)において、ユーザーが独自のアニメーションアイコンを設定するための詳細な手順とその背景について、専門的な視点から解説いたします。近年の技術進展とは関係なく、本ガイドは汎用性の高い基本的な操作プロセスに焦点を当てており、初心者から中級者まで幅広く対応できる内容となっています。

1. MetaMaskとは何か?

MetaMaskは、イーサリアム(Ethereum)ベースの分散型アプリケーション(DApp)を安全に利用するために設計されたウェブウォレットです。ブラウザ拡張機能として提供されており、ユーザーは自身の暗号資産(仮想通貨)やトークンを管理し、スマートコントラクトとのインタラクションを行うことが可能です。特に、非中央集権的な金融システム(DeFi)やNFT(非代替性トークン)取引において、極めて重要な役割を果たしています。

MetaMaskの特徴の一つとして、ユーザビリティの高さが挙げられます。シンプルなインターフェースにより、複雑な鍵管理やトランザクション署名のプロセスを平易に実現しており、多くのユーザーが安心して利用しています。また、プライバシー保護の観点からも、ユーザーの個人情報や資産情報を外部に公開しない設計が採られています。

2. アニメーションアイコンの意味と重要性

MetaMaskのアカウントアイコンは、通常は静止画像で表示されますが、ユーザーは独自のアニメーションファイル(GIF形式など)をアップロードすることで、動的なアイコンを設定することが可能です。この機能は単なる装飾ではなく、以下のような重要な意義を持っています。

  • ブランド認知の強化:個人または団体が独自のアイコンを使用することで、自分のアカウントやプロジェクトの識別性が向上します。
  • ユーザー体験の質向上:アニメーションによって、操作の確認や状態の変化を直感的に把握でき、より洗練されたインターフェース体験が可能になります。
  • コミュニティの一体感醸成:特定のプロジェクトやコミュニティ内で共通のアニメーションアイコンを共有することで、結束感や帰属意識が高まります。
注意:アニメーションアイコンの設定には、一定の技術的知識が必要であり、適切なフォーマットとサイズのファイルを使用することが必須です。

3. アニメーションアイコン設定の前提条件

アニメーションアイコンを設定する前に、以下の環境と準備が整っている必要があります。

  • 最新版のMetaMask拡張機能がインストール済みであること(例:Chrome, Firefox, Braveなど)
  • 使用するアニメーションファイルがGIF形式であること(他の形式はサポートされていません)
  • ファイルサイズが512KB未満であること(制限値は公式ドキュメントによる)
  • アニメーションのフレーム数が100以下であること(長すぎるアニメーションは読み込みに時間がかかるため)
  • 画像の解像度が128×128ピクセル以上、256×256ピクセル以下であること

これらの条件を満たさない場合、アップロードが拒否されるか、正しく表示されない可能性があります。特に、ファイルサイズや解像度の制限は、ウェブパフォーマンスの最適化とユーザー体験の維持のために設けられています。

4. アニメーションアイコンの作成手順

以下のステップに従って、MetaMaskにアニメーションアイコンを設定できます。

4.1. アニメーションファイルの作成

まず、目的のデザインに基づいてアニメーションを作成する必要があります。以下のようなツールが推奨されます:

  • Adobe Photoshop + GIF Animator:プロフェッショナルな編集が可能なため、高品質なアニメーション制作に適しています。
  • GIMP(GNU Image Manipulation Program):無料で利用可能なオープンソースソフトウェアであり、多くの機能を備えています。
  • Online GIF Maker(例:ezgif.com):Web上で簡単にアニメーションを作成・エクスポートできるサービスです。

作成時のポイントとして、以下の事項に注意してください:

  • 色数を256色以下に抑えることで、ファイルサイズの削減が可能になります。
  • ループ回数を「無限ループ」に設定すると、常に再生されるため、ユーザーの視覚的な認識が安定します。
  • 透明背景(アルファチャンネル)を使用する場合は、PNG形式ではなく、GIF形式でも対応可能ですが、注意が必要です。

4.2. ファイルの最適化

作成したアニメーションファイルは、必ず最適化処理を行ってから使用してください。以下のような手法が有効です:

  • エクスポート時に「Interlaced(インターレース)」オプションを無効にする
  • フレーム間の差分を最小限に抑える(不要な変化を削除)
  • 必要最低限のフレーム数で表現する(例:10~20フレーム程度で十分な場合が多い)

最適化により、ファイルサイズが大幅に削減され、MetaMaskでの読み込み速度が向上し、動作の遅延を回避できます。

4.3. MetaMaskへのアップロード

以下の手順で、MetaMaskの設定画面からアニメーションアイコンをアップロードします。

  1. Chromeブラウザなどで、右上隅のMetaMaskアイコンをクリックし、拡張機能のポップアップを開きます。
  2. 画面下部にある「プロフィール設定」または「アカウントの設定」をクリックします。
  3. アカウント情報のページで、「アイコン」の部分をクリックします。
  4. 「画像を選択」ボタンを押下し、事前に準備したGIFファイルを読み込みます。
  5. ファイルが正しく読み込まれると、プレビュー表示が行われ、確認画面が表示されます。
  6. 問題がなければ「保存」または「適用」ボタンをクリックします。

設定後、元のアイコンがアニメーションに切り替わることが確認できます。一部の環境では、再起動後に反映される場合もあります。

5. 設定後の確認とトラブルシューティング

アニメーションアイコンを設定した後は、以下の点を確認しましょう。

  • アイコンが正常に再生されているか(一時停止や途中で止まらないか)
  • 他のデバイスやブラウザでも同じように表示されるか
  • ネットワーク接続が不安定な場合、アニメーションが正しく読み込まれないことがある

もしアニメーションが表示されない場合は、以下の原因をチェックしてください:

  • ファイルサイズが512KBを超えている
  • GIF形式以外のファイル(例:MP4、APNG)を指定している
  • フレーム数が多すぎて読み込みに失敗している
  • MetaMaskのキャッシュが古いため、更新されていない

キャッシュをクリアするには、ブラウザの設定から「履歴の削除」を行い、「キャッシュされた画像やファイル」を削除し、再度MetaMaskを再読み込みしてください。

6. セキュリティに関する注意事項

アニメーションアイコンの設定は、一般的なユーザーインターフェースのカスタマイズに過ぎませんが、セキュリティ面でのリスクも考慮する必要があります。

  • 第三者が提供するアニメーションファイルをダウンロードする際は、信頼できるソースからのみ取得すること
  • 悪意のあるコードが埋め込まれたGIFファイルをアップロードすると、ブラウザに不審な挙動を引き起こす可能性がある
  • MetaMask自体は、アップロードされたファイルの内容を検証していないため、ユーザー自身が責任を持ってファイルを管理すること

特に、NFTや仮想通貨取引に関連するアカウントに対しては、異常なアイコン表示が詐欺の兆候である場合もあるため、慎重な判断が求められます。

7. 結論

MetaMaskにおけるアニメーションアイコンの設定は、ユーザーの個性表現とデジタルアイデンティティの強化に寄与する重要な機能です。本ガイドを通じて、必要な前提条件、作成手順、最適化方法、およびトラブルシューティングのポイントを体系的に学ぶことができました。技術的な制約やセキュリティリスクを理解した上で、安全かつ効果的にこの機能を利用することで、より豊かなブロックチェーン体験が実現します。

本記事は、あくまで技術的な操作ガイドとしての役割を果たすものであり、未来の技術進展とは無関係に、現在の標準的な運用方法を正確に伝えることを目的としています。ユーザー一人ひとりが、自身のデジタルライフを丁寧に構築していく力を持つことが、まさに分散型技術の真の価値であると言えるでしょう。

まとめ:MetaMaskのアニメーションアイコン設定は、単なる装飾ではなく、ユーザーの自己表現とセキュリティ意識の両方を高めるための有用なツールです。適切な準備と注意深さをもって実行すれば、快適で個性的なウォレット環境を構築することができます。


前の記事

MetaMask(メタマスク)の言語設定を日本語に変更する手順

次の記事

MetaMask(メタマスク)の投資リスクと注意すべきポイント

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です